Beth C. Grossman Law LLC works with individuals, families, and fiduciaries on all aspects of estate planning and estate and trust administration. Blending our legal and tax expertise and training, we deliver tax-effective strategies, guidance, and solutions throughout the planning and administration processes.
Clients engage the firm to create or refine estate plans that match their goals, long-term planning, and financial picture, with careful coordination across documents, taxes, and assets. Estate planning services offered range from core planning (wills, revocable trusts, and living documents) to advanced planning (irrevocable trusts, family entities, and other lifetime gifting strategies) to accomplish goals for asset protection, probate avoidance, estate tax minimization, and more.
On the estate and trust administration side, we guide clients carefully through the entirety of the administration process to address all requisite steps and deliver a smooth and effective administration experience, while also considering post-mortem tax planning opportunities as applicable.
